Phoneme
The smallest unit of sound in a language that can distinguish one word from another, such as the difference between the sounds /p/ and /b/.

Cochlear Implant
A device that transforms sounds into electric pulses that directly stimulate the auditory nerve, bypassing the malfunctioning inner ear that ordinarily processes sound.
Auditory Nerve
A cranial nerve that transmits sound information from the cochlea in the inner ear to the brain.
